About Ghordaur Village

Ghordaur is a mid sized village in Pratappur tehsil, in the district of Chatra, Jharkh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,513, made up of 735 males and 778 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,059 females per 1000 males. The village covers 228 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 825404,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Ghordaur

The census records public bus service for Ghordaur as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
